Nicolle Wallace
New York - UPI

Reputed lame-duck panelist Nicolle Wallace is indicating she has heard the reports saying ABC won't hire her back full-time next season for The View.

Variety reported Wednesday that Wallace -- a former White House communications director and the show's lone conservative co-host -- wasn't asked to return for a second season because she wasn't argumentative enough or overly interested in celebrity gossip. The network has not officially commented about her future with the show, however.

"So, what's new?" moderator Whoopi Goldberg asked Wallace at the beginning of Thursday's edition of the chat show.

"Not much," Wallace laughed, hanging her head and blushing.

"I promised my husband I wouldn't do this. Sorry, honey," she continued. "You know, there's a lot of news and a story about our show, always, right? And about me, lately, and it's hard. People have said a lot of things about me over the years. I've worked for very controversial politicians. These stories crossed a line, though, Whoop."

"Yes, I know they did, go ahead," Goldberg said, patting Wallace's hand.

"They called me Kardashian illiterate," Wallace said before rattling off rapid-fire, but concise and accurate backgrounds for each member of the reality TV dynasty.

"An injustice has been perpetrated on me," she declared as the crowd laughed and cheered. "I just want everyone to know that even I have a line that can't be crossed. Don't ever diss my Kardashian knowledge. That's all."

"You know way more about the Kardashians than I do. I just want people to understand that you demand respect and I respect the hell out of you," co-host Rosie Perez told her as the audience applauded.

"I feel better," Wallace said.

"You should feel better because I have to tell you if that was the way to get off this bad boy, I'd have been gone ages ago. I know nothing about the Kardashians. Don't care. They are very nice people, I'm sure, but they don't pay my rent, don't do jack for me," Goldberg said, before moving on to a discussion about the previous evening's ESPY Awards.

Perez announced last week that she would not return after the show's summer hiatus. Confirmed to appear on the program for Season 19 are Goldberg and new hires Raven-Symone and Michelle Collins.
